TERMINAL FITTING AND CHAIN TERMINAL - A simplified explanation of the abstract

This abstract first appeared for US patent application 18570227 titled 'TERMINAL FITTING AND CHAIN TERMINAL

The patent application aims to provide a terminal fitting and a chain terminal capable of maintaining connection reliability to a mating terminal.

  • The terminal fitting includes a box portion for inserting a mating terminal from the front, a base portion fixed in the box portion, a contact portion for electrically contacting the mating terminal, and a spring portion linking the base portion and the contact portion to support the contact portion displaceably in the insertion direction of the mating terminal.
  • The spring portion is designed with multiple plate portions folded and linked in a direction intersecting the insertion direction, spaced apart in the insertion direction.

Original Abstract Submitted

It is aimed to provide a terminal fitting and a chain terminal capable of maintaining connection reliability to a mating terminal. A terminal fitting () is provided with a box portion , into which a mating terminal is inserted from front, a base portion () fixed in the box portion (), a contact portion () arranged forward of the base portion () and configured to electrically contact the mating terminal () being inserted into the box portion (), and a spring portion () provided to link the base portion () and the contact portion () and support the contact portion () displaceably in an insertion direction (R) of the mating terminal (). The spring portion () is shaped such that a plurality of plate portions (A) elongated in a direction intersecting the insertion direction (R) are folded and linked while being spaced apart in the insertion direction (R).
